What is a Wiring Diagram For Distributor and How is it Used?

A Wiring Diagram For Distributor is essentially a visual representation of the electrical connections related to your car's ignition distributor. It shows the various wires, their colors, their destinations, and the components they connect to. Think of it as a map for electricity within your ignition system. Without this map, tracing a fault becomes a guessing game. The importance of a Wiring Diagram For Distributor cannot be overstated; it's the key to understanding the intricate dance of electrical energy that powers your engine.

These diagrams are indispensable tools for several reasons. They help in troubleshooting. When your car isn't starting or is running rough, the distributor's wiring is a prime suspect. A wiring diagram allows you to systematically check each connection, identify any breaks, shorts, or incorrect wiring. It also aids in installation and modification. If you're replacing a distributor or adding performance components, the diagram ensures you connect everything correctly. They also serve as a reference for understanding how the ignition system works as a whole, including the interplay between the distributor, ignition coil, spark plugs, and the engine control unit (ECU).

To better understand how these diagrams are used, consider the common elements you'll find:

  • Wires: Represented by lines, often with color codes indicated.
  • Components: Symbols for the distributor itself, ignition coil, points (in older systems), condenser, and sometimes the ECU.
  • Connectors: Show how different parts are joined together.

Using the diagram involves following the path of electricity. For instance, you'd trace the wire from the ignition coil's positive terminal to its connection on the distributor. Then, you'd follow the wire from the distributor's trigger mechanism (like points or a sensor) to its destination, often the ECU or an ignition module. This methodical approach is far more efficient than random probing.
